Pebble Beach will host its first Women’s US Open this July, and this is where the top contenders can try to qualify.
On Tuesday, the USGA announced 23 sites for its 36-hole qualifiers. Qualifiers will be held from May 9 to June 7 in 17 US states, Canada, Japan and Belgium.
Applications open February 15 and close May 3 at 5:00 pm ET. To be eligible, the player must have a handicap index of 2.4 or less or be a professional.
“The USGA is delighted to bring the Women’s US Open and the world’s top players to Pebble Beach Golf Links, one of America’s iconic and treasured courses,” said John Bodenhamer, USGA Chief Championships Officer. “The qualification process is highly regarded by the USGA, and we thank the Allied Golf Association in the United States and the international golf community for providing thousands of golfers with the opportunity to compete for a place in the championship.”
Two qualifying venues, Starmount Forest Country Club in Greensboro, North Carolina and Druid Hills Golf Club in Atlanta, previously hosted the U.S. Women’s Open, the first in 1947 and the second in 1951.
Birdie Kim in 2005 became the last player to win the Women’s US Open after qualifying.
The USGA received a record 1,874 entries for the 2022 US Women’s Open at Pine Needles.
